Si David at Jacko: Ang Batang Bruha

AUTHOR Lim, Joyce; Seroya, Tea; Downie, David
PUBLISHER Blue Peg Publishing (04/25/2014)
PRODUCT TYPE Paperback (Paperback)

Description

TAGALOG EDITION

Nadama nina David at Jacko ang pinakamatinding takot noong nagorasyon ng may kakaibang salita ang isang kamag-aral at napinsala ang utak ng kanilang punong-guro. Ang kanilang pag-usisa ay humantong sa sakuna at walang pagpipilian si David kundi magtago sa mga puno upang lihim na mapag-aralan ang aklat ng kanyang kamag-aral bago sila humantong sa kanilang kamatayan.

David and Jacko fear the worst when a classmate chants strange words and brain damages their headmaster. Their curiosity soon leads to disaster and David has no choice but to sneak into the trees to study his classmate's secret book before they both meet their untimely end.

Suitable for ages 8 and up.

Author: Downie, David
David Downie, a native San Franciscan, lived in New York, Providence, Rome and Milan before moving to Paris in the mid-1980s. He divides his time between France and Italy. His travel, food and arts features have appeared in print publications worldwide. Downie is co-owner with his wife Alison Harris of Paris, "Paris" Tours custom walking tours of Paris, Burgundy, Rome & the Italian Riviera. He is the author of the critically acclaimed "Paris, Paris", and the bestselling "Paris to the Pyrenees".
